🛒 Ingredients

  • Beef stewing cubes 100 g · 250 kcal
  • Onion 30 g · 12 kcal
  • Carrot 30 g · 12 kcal
  • Potato 60 g · 46 kcal
  • Canned diced tomatoes 60 g · 12 kcal
  • Vegetable oil 6 g · 54 kcal
  • Maize meal (white cornmeal) 60 g · 216 kcal
  • Butter 3 g · 21 kcal
  • Beef broth 80 g · 4 kcal
  • Water 180 g · 0 kcal

👨‍🍳 Instructions

  1. For the Vleis (Stew): Heat vegetable o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Brown the beef stewing cubes on all sides; remove and set aside.
  2. Add chopped onion, carrots, and potatoes to the pot; sauté for about 5-7 minutes until softened. Stir in the diced tomatoes, paprika, chili powder, and black pepper.
  3. Return the browned beef to the pot, add beef broth and bay leaf, then bring to a simmer. Reduce heat to low, cover, and let it slow cook for 1.5 to 2 hours, or until the beef is very tender.
  4. For the Pap: In a separate medium saucepan, bring 180ml of water to a boil. Gradually whisk in the maize meal, stirring constantly to prevent lumps.
  5.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ook the pap for about 20-30 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it forms a thick, firm porridge. Stir in the butter until fully incorporated.
  6. Serve the tender beef stew (Vleis) generously alongside the hot, firm maize meal porridge (Pap). Garnish with fresh herbs if desired.
